A lot of people have been saying how difficult this game is, and it's mainly because of a lack of a very important game mechanic, which is invincibility frames. Currently, the zombies damage you every frame that they attack, which causes a lot of problems, the first of which is knocking you into a wall and basically making you stuck. I am not sure how you check collision for the player, but a pretty good solution is to just take no knockback against a direction when your hitbox is touching a wall.

Do you know Sans🩻  from Undertale? He's a pretty well-known character, and his boss fight is infamous for being extremely hard. There are a couple gimmicks he has that makes him this hard, one of which is Karma💜 poisoning, which is not relevant here, and the second is that he ignores your i-frames, which means he damages you every frame, which means he kills you in seconds if you're touching one of his attacks. Now, this guy is meant to be the hardest boss in a rather difficult game, and every other enemy in the game follows the i-frame rules, being only able to damage you only once every 30 frames(with some exceptions).

Now contrast this with your game, where the zombies damage you every frame, killing you in seconds. Sure, they die from a few bullets, but they can also ignore walls, and come from behind you, and instantly kill you when you're in a dead end. Just 25 frames of invincibility (of course buffing the zombies to go with it) can significantly improve the game, and will make it way fairer.
